Nvidia CEO Says AI Will Be a Permanent Micromanaging Boss Who Never Stops Nagging You

TL;DR

Nvidia CEO Jensen Huang suggested that AI will function as a constant, ever-present manager that monitors and nudges workers continuously. The vision positions AI less as a helpful assistant and more as an inescapable digital overseer. Huang's comments spark debate about how much AI-driven supervision is actually desirable in the workplace—and where the line between productivity tool and surveillance lies.

Nauti's Take

Huang's framing is deliberately provocative — but he touches on something real. AI-assisted workflow monitoring can improve efficiency and catch blind spots humans miss.

At the same time, constant surveillance is psychologically taxing and erodes intrinsic motivation over time. The line between a useful coaching layer and a digital panopticon is thin, and who controls that line matters enormously.
